aka California Lilac

Std. An attractive evergreen shrub which features sparkling clusters of dark blue flowers in late spring. The shiny foliage turns a deeps ebony shade during winter, changing to dark chocolate-green during spring and summer. Quite hardy and tolerant of wind and cold. PVR 1334.

Ceanothus fix nitrogen from the atmosphere so require no fertiliser.

aka Korokio

A tough, hardy shrub discovered by the late Mike Geenty in the Waikato. A top plant for hedging or topiary. Attractive olive-green leaves, small yellow flowers in spring followed by red berries that birds love. Tolerates regular trimming. Presented here as a topiary standard. Evergreen.

Corokia are tolerant of coastal conditions and thrive in just about any soil though their preference is for an open sunny site. Very quick to establish. Can be grown in a container.
